Ujhazy

Karoly Ujhazy, 85, of Cortland died Thursday, March 26, 1981, at Cortland Memorial Hospital. Funeral services were conducted March 28.

He was born in Hungary, the son of Istvan and Margaret Ujhazy. Mr. Ujhazy was a communicant of St. Mary’s Church and a member of the MHBK Organization.

He was a colonel in the Hungarian Kingdom's Artillery and the last commander of Budapest Air Defense during World War II.

Surviving are his wife, Illona Szabo Ujhazy of Cortland and a daughter, Maria Csemez of Boston.
